The Real Ass Word - aka RAW - is a juicy little podcast on conscious living in a toxic world. Hosted by Ali, the founder of @thecheekyclean a wellness brand connecting intentional consumers with the purposeful brands of the future. Through the power of shared resources, connection, community and REAL experience - each episode will provide tangible tips for detoxing the mind, body and spirit to elevate the collective and easily navigate the oversaturated wellness business. Your BS free resource for living longer, lighter and more holistic.

    The Other Side of Addiction ft. Marisa Barber

    Addiction doesn't just affect the person struggling — it affects every single person who loves them. In this episode, Alison sits down with Marisa Barber, author of The Other Side of Addiction and Senior Manager of Patient Support Services for a telehealth addiction treatment program, to talk about the grief, shame, and silence that families carry when someone they love is struggling with substance use. Marisa draws from her professional experience in addiction recovery and her own devastating personal loss — the overdose death of her partner — to explore what healing actually looks like for families. They discuss boundaries, recovery, Al-Anon, medication-assisted treatment, stigma, and the radical power of telling the truth about our stories. Whether you've walked this road yourself or love someone who has, this conversation will remind you that you are not alone.     The Truth About Organic, Local Food & Living Better ft. Kawai Bitto

    What if the most powerful thing you could do for your health was simply knowing where your food comes from? This week, Ali sits down with Kawai Bitto, Director of Market Operations at North Union Farmers Market, for a rich conversation on local food systems, food access, seasonal eating, and the real-life impact of supporting small farms and local makers. They dig into why local often beats organic, how farmers markets serve every budget (SNAP, WIC, and Produce Perks included), how motherhood shapes food choices, and what it means to vote with your dollars — one market visit at a time. 🍑This episode is brought to you by TheCheekyClean Collagen.     The Truth About GLP-1s ft Gretchen Spetz, RD

    In this episode of RAW, host Alison Hite (founder of TheCheekyClean and Conscious Cart) sits down with registered dietitian and functional nutrition specialist Gretchen Spetz to break down the smart, sustainable approach to GLP-1 weight loss. They cover why GLP-1 medications like semaglutide are not a magic fix, and what your body actually needs to lose weight without sacrificing muscle, metabolism, or long-term health. From protein and fiber to sleep, gut health, strength training, and nervous system regulation — this episode is a complete framework for anyone navigating midlife health, hormonal shifts, or metabolic changes.
